CHEESE SAVOURY (SANDWICH FILLING)
A North Eastern classic sandwich filling from England and one that was made famous by Gregg's the Bakers of Gosforth in Newcastle-upon-Tyne. Traditionally used to fill "stotty cake" sandwiches, this is a fabulous vegetarian spread for the school or office lunch box.
Categories Lunch, Salad, Side Dish, Snack
Yield 8 sandwiches
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Mix the grated cheese, carrot and onion in a bowl and then add salad cream spoon by spoon, until a spreadable and creamy consistency has been achieved.
- Adjust seasoning with salt and pepper and leave for at least 4 hours in the fridge before using. Keeps for up to 4 to 5 days in a covered container in the fridge.
- Makes 8 rounds of sandwiches or 8 bread rolls.
CHEESE SAVOURY SANDWICH FILLING
This cheese savoury recipe makes a fantastic filling for afternoon tea sandwiches. A step up from basic cheese, this cheese savoury sandwich is easy to make and full of flavour.This recipe makes sufficient filling for 16 dainty afternoon tea sandwiches approx 3 cm x 8 cm
Provided by Jane Saunders
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Begin by chopping the red pepper finely and leaving to drain on kitchen paper
- Next, finely dice salad onion
- Mix mayonnaise with paprika and dijon mustard
- Grate the cheddar cheese and Red Leicester cheese finely, then toss together in a bowl - use your hands, it's easy this way
- Add in the pepper & onion and mix again with your hands
- Finally, stir in the mayonnaise using a metal spoon
- Cover and chill until ready to use
- Cut the crusts from the bread
- Cut one of the slices of bread in half - we will only cut 1 sandwich from this slice
- Lay 5 of the full-sized slices out, along with one of the smaller pieces of bread
- Stir the filling briefly and spoon a generous amount onto each slice of laid out bread, spreading it out using a blunt knife
- Top each slice with another piece of bread of equal size
- Cut into slices - my bread allowed 3 sandwiches to be cut from each large piece of bread and just one from the smaller sandwich. In total, you should cut 16 small sandwiches
- Cover until ready to serve and consume as soon as possible (within the hour to avoid the bread drying out)

OBATZDA - BAVARIAN SAVORY CHEESE SPREAD : 8 STEPS (WITH ...
From instructables.com
Estimated Reading Time 6 mins
- Ingredients. 1 small Camembert (125g - that equals about 4.5 ounces) 1,5 heaped teaspoons of powdered sweet paprika. 0,5 teaspoon caraway seeds. 1 tablespoon of fine diced onion (I cut them as small as possible, the smaller they are the better they integrate / dissolve into the spread...)
- Dice. Place your Camembert on a plate and find a pretty Hand model who cuts the Camembert into little dices. No need to be especially accurate, it will be mashed soon anyway...
- Mix. Add 1,5 teaspoons of sweet powdered paprika, half a teaspoon on caraway seeds and about a tablespoon of super fine dices onions. Mix everything together.
- Mash. Add about three tablespoons of cream cheese. Continue mishmashing squishsquashing everything together. Use a tool according to your preferences: My grandma prefers to use a knife, I like to use a fork.
- Squash. Mix and mash and squash until the spread reaches your desired consistency. It usually takes about three to five minutes to get it right.
- Shape It. Traditionally the Obatzda is served on a plate and shaped like a dome, but my grandma prefers to shape it like a disk. Use a knife to shape the cheese spread according to your styling preferences.
- Enjoy. I enjoy Obatzda the most one or two hours after it's mashed together, I think the flavors develop even better after a little resting time.
- Serving Suggestions and Variations. This rustic hearty snack goes very well with a glass of beer or Radler (beer and lemonade). Pretzels and lye rolls are a perfect base for this spread.
